RESPONSIBILITIES:
Payroll Processing & Support
- Process and assist with weekly and bi-weekly payroll for U.S., Puerto Rico, Canada, and union team members.
- Assist with weekly and bi-weekly payroll processing for U.S., Puerto Rico, Canada, and union team members.
- Calculate, process, and reconcile payroll deductions including taxes, benefits, 401(k) contributions, garnishments, and court-ordered deductions.
- Audit payroll and timekeeping data for accuracy prior to processing.
- Review payroll reports to identify and resolve errors, missing items, or inconsistencies.
- Support payroll adjustments including PTO, leaves of absence, and one-time payments.
- Process payroll corrections as needed.
- Maintain payroll documentation and tracking records.
- Assist with payroll tax setup and maintenance within the HRIS.
- Support unclaimed wage verifications and required filings.

Reconciliation & Reporting
- Assist in resolving payroll errors and reconciling variances.
- Support payroll reporting, including Multiple Worksite reporting.
- Administer Canadian Records of Employment (ROEs).
Year-End & Compliance
- Assist with year-end processes including tax form preparation and audits.
